During the 2 hour private workshop and mini-factory tour conduct by Nury Dian Xin (one of Singapore's largest halal dim sum producer), you and your private group (of up to 24 pax) will get hands-on experience in pleating and test your creativity in making fancy looking paus to bring home. You will get to taste some of our dim sums and have a better understanding on the truly Singapore blend of chinese and malay flavours in Nury's Premium Dim Sum. Also, learn the manufacturing process of our paus and compliance with the various accreditation requirements and our partnerships with the community to combat food waste. For vegetarians, please contact us at least 24 hours prior to the workshop so that our instructors can prepare some suitable food item for you.
